Activities

The King's Cross Brunswick Neighbourhood Association is a registered charity that is led by local residents for the benefit of local residents. We have 3 community centres that provide a cradle to grave service to the diverse community of the King's Cross, Brunswick area of the London Borough of Camden. We work with Bangladeshi, Somali, Chinese, Refugee and indigenous white community.

Objects: To Promote All Or Any Purpose Which Is Charitable According To English Law And Which Will Benefit The Inhabitants Of The King's Cross And Brunswick Electoral Wards Of The London Borough Of Camden (Hereinafter Called "The Area Of Benefit" Without Distinction Of Sex, Sexual Orientation, Race Or Of Political Religious Or Other Opinions And In Particular (But Without Prejudice To The Generality Of The Foregoing):(a) By Associating Together The Said Inhabitants And The Local Authorities, Voluntary And Other Organisations In A Common Effort To Advance Education And To Provide Facilities In The Interests Of Social Welfare For Recreation And Leisure-Time Occupation With The Object Of Improving The Condition Of Life Of The Said Inhabitants;(b) To Establish Or Secure The Establishment Of Community Centres (Currently The Marchmont Community Centre And The Chadswell Healthy Living Centre) And To Manage The Same (Whether Alone Of In Co-Operation With Any Local Authority Or Other Person Or Body) In Furtherance Of These Objects;(c) To Relieve Elderly, Sick Or Disabled Inhabitants In The Area Of Benefit;(d) To Relieve Elderly Persons In The Area Of Benefit;(e) To Promote The Preservation And Protection Of Health For The Benefit Of The Said Inhabitants;(f) To Promote High Standards Of Planning And Architecture In Or Affecting The Area Of Benefit.
